Brief Summary

Assessment of safety and efficacy of cell injection therapy generated using non-cultured human corneal endothelial cells in treating corneal endothelial dysfunction

Outcome Measures

Primary Outcomes (1)

  • BSCVA

    Snellen best spectacle-corrected visual acuity (BSCVA). The Snellen BSCVA will be converted to logarithm of the minimum angle of resolution visual acuity for statistical analysis.

    1, 3, 6, 12 months post-operatively

Eligibility Criteria

Age18 Years - 80 Years
Sexall
Healthy VolunteersNo
Age GroupsAdult (18-64), Older Adult (65+)

You may qualify if:

  • Patients who have mild to moderate corneal endothelial decompensation or bullous keratopathy, but with minimal corneal stromal scarring resulting from irreversible post-surgical corneal decompensation, specifically, all forms of pseudophakic or aphakic bullous keratopathy.

You may not qualify if:

  • Severe forms or late-stage presentation of corneal decompensation with severe corneal stromal scarring and or scarring to the DM, unsuitable for SNEC-I.
  • Patients with complex anterior segment complications precluding a successful SNEC-I procedure
  • Patients who have other forms of endothelial dystrophy, traumatic corneal decompensation, or post-inflammatory corneal decompensation
  • Post-laser iridotomy or glaucoma related corneal decompensation
  • Patients not keen to participate in the clinical trial
  • Patients who are below 21 years of age or above 80 years of age
  • Patients who are pregnant
  • Patients who are cognitively impaired
  • Patients who are prisoners
  • Patients with antibiotics/antimycotics allergies
